Weight Loss and Fitness Tips for Busy Women
Introduction
In today's fast-paced world, many women struggle to find time for fitness and healthy eating. Between work, family responsibilities, and daily commitments, maintaining a healthy lifestyle can seem challenging. However, achieving weight loss and staying fit doesn't require spending hours in the gym or following extreme diets.
Many women make common mistakes such as eating too little, skipping meals, following unrealistic diet plans, or expecting instant results. Sustainable weight loss comes from building healthy habits, eating a balanced diet, and staying physically active.
Remember, fitness is a journey, not a quick fix. Small, consistent changes can lead to long-term success and better overall health.
Common Weight Loss Mistakes Women Should Avoid
Before discussing effective strategies, it's important to understand what not to do.
Avoid These Common Mistakes:
Skipping meals
Following crash diets
Eating too few calories
Relying on unhealthy weight-loss supplements
Expecting overnight results
Ignoring strength training
Not getting enough sleep
Healthy weight loss should be gradual, sustainable, and focused on overall well-being.
1. Never Skip Breakfast
Breakfast is often considered the most important meal of the day.
A nutritious breakfast provides your body with the energy needed to stay active, focused, and productive throughout the day.
A Healthy Breakfast Should Include:
✔ Protein
✔ Fiber
✔ Healthy fats
✔ Vitamins and minerals
✔ Complex carbohydrates
Healthy Breakfast Ideas
Oats with fruits and nuts
Vegetable poha
Whole-grain toast with eggs
Greek yogurt with berries
Smoothies with fruits and protein
Starting your day with a balanced breakfast can help control hunger and reduce unhealthy snacking later in the day.
2. Replace Junk Food with Healthy Snacks
Healthy snacking can help manage hunger, maintain energy levels, and support weight-loss goals.
Avoid Frequent Consumption Of:
❌ Chips
❌ Sugary drinks
❌ Cookies
❌ Processed snacks
Choose Healthier Alternatives:
✅ Fruits
✅ Nuts and seeds
✅ Roasted chickpeas
✅ Yogurt
✅ Protein-rich snacks
Nutritious snacks provide essential nutrients while helping you avoid overeating during main meals.
3. Follow a Structured Exercise Routine
Exercise doesn't have to be complicated.
Even busy women can achieve excellent results by following a simple and consistent fitness routine.
Effective Exercises Include:
Walking
Jogging
Cycling
Swimming
Yoga
Strength training
Home workouts
Recommended Activity Level
Aim for:
At least 150 minutes of moderate exercise per week
or
75 minutes of vigorous exercise per week
Adding strength training 2–3 times weekly can help improve muscle tone and boost metabolism.
4. Stay Hydrated Throughout the Day
Water plays a crucial role in maintaining overall health and supporting weight management.
Benefits of Proper Hydration
✔ Improves digestion
✔ Supports metabolism
✔ Prevents dehydration
✔ Enhances workout performance
✔ Helps control appetite
Aim to drink at least 2–3 litres of water daily, especially if you exercise regularly.
Keeping a reusable water bottle nearby can make it easier to stay hydrated throughout the day.
5. Choose Smart Carbohydrates Instead of Eliminating Them
One common misconception is that all carbohydrates are bad.
In reality, your body needs carbohydrates for energy.
Limit Refined Carbohydrates Such As:
White bread
Sugary snacks
Cakes and pastries
Sweetened beverages
Choose Healthy Carbohydrates Such As:
Oats
Brown rice
Quinoa
Sweet potatoes
Whole grains
Fruits and vegetables
Rather than completely eliminating carbs, focus on choosing nutrient-rich sources and maintaining proper portion sizes.
Additional Fitness Tips for Busy Women
Prioritize Sleep
Poor sleep can increase hunger hormones and make weight loss more difficult.
Aim for:
7–9 hours of quality sleep every night.
Manage Stress
Chronic stress can contribute to weight gain and unhealthy eating habits.
Consider:
Meditation
Deep breathing exercises
Yoga
Walking outdoors
Journaling
Be Consistent
Consistency is more important than perfection.
You don't need to have a perfect diet or workout every day. Focus on making healthier choices most of the time.
Small efforts repeated consistently create lasting results.
